Committee on Health
Assembly Bill 653
Relating to: requiring facilities that perform mammography examinations to provide notice to certain patients regarding dense breast tissue and granting rule-making authority.

December 20, 2017 Executive Session Held
Present: (12) Representative Sanfelippo; Representatives Bernier, Edming, Skowronski, Kremer, Wichgers, Murphy, Jacque, Kolste, Zamarripa, Subeck and C. Taylor.
Absent: (0) None.
Excused: (0) None.
Moved by Representative Bernier, seconded by Representative Taylor that Assembly Bill 653 be recommended for passage.
Ayes: (12) Representative Sanfelippo; Representatives Bernier, Edming, Skowronski, Kremer, Wichgers, Murphy, Jacque, Kolste, Zamarripa, Subeck and C. Taylor.
Noes: (0) None.
PASSAGE RECOMMENDED, Ayes 12, Noes 0
